- Abstract: Random number generators are a vital component in many cryptographic algorithms and systems, such as generation of keys in secret key cryptography and public key cryptography. For cryptographic applications, True Random Number Generator utilizes unpredictability as the key component. Insufficient entropy produces predictable keys, so the major concern is to have a better entropy source. Entropy source which is based on a delay chain structure is presented in this paper. Here the randomness is generated by the timing differential existing between the clock and the data signal. In this design the delays are adjusted so that the data can be sampled at the limit of switching point The proposed design is very simple as it is based on a loop structure which does not contain any complex structures like Delay Locked Loop (DLL).
